History - net.minecraft.world.level.block.SideChainPartBlock

25w31a

Names

dyi

net.minecraft.world.level.block.SideChainPartBlock

net.minecraft.class_11587

net.minecraft.block.SideChaining

Fields

Constructors

Methods

SideChainPart (BlockState): p, getSideChainPart, method_72619, getSideChainPart

BlockState (BlockState, SideChainPart): a, setSideChainPart, method_72617, withSideChainPart

Direction (BlockState): r, getFacing, method_72620, getFacing

boolean (BlockState): s, isConnectable, method_72621, canChainWith

int (): d, getMaxChainLength, method_72618, getMaxSideChainLength

List<BlockPos> (LevelAccessor, BlockPos): a, getAllBlocksConnectedTo, method_72623, getPositionsInChain

void (IntFunction<SideChainPartBlock$Neighbor>, SideChainPart, Consumer<BlockPos>): a, addBlocksConnectingTowards, method_72628, forEachNeighborTowards

void (LevelAccessor, BlockPos, BlockState): a_, updateNeighborsAfterPoweringDown, method_72629, disconnectNeighbors

void (LevelAccessor, BlockPos, BlockState, BlockState): a, updateSelfAndNeighborsOnPoweringUp, method_72624, connectNeighbors

boolean (int, int): a, canConnect, method_72622, canAddChainLength

boolean (BlockState, BlockState): a, isBeingUpdatedByNeighbor, method_72627, isAlreadyConnected

SideChainPartBlock$Neighbors (LevelAccessor, BlockPos, Direction): a, getNeighbors, method_72626, getNeighbors

void (LevelAccessor, BlockPos, SideChainPart): a, setPart, method_72625, setSideChainPart